Key Responsibilities

  • Serve as Project Manager and Engineer of Record on structural engineering projects
  • Lead project planning, scheduling, budgeting, and execution
  • Perform and oversee structural analysis and design for steel, concrete, masonry, and wood systems
  • Review and approve calculations, drawings, and specifications
  • Coordinate with architects, owners, contractors, and other design disciplines
  • Mentor and provide technical guidance to junior engineers and designers
  • Conduct site visits, field observations, and constructability reviews
  • Support business development efforts including proposals and client presentations
  • Uphold quality control standards and ensure compliance with applicable codes and regulations

Required Qualifications

  • B.S. or M.S. in Civil or Structural Engineering from an accredited institution
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license required
  • 5+ years of structural engineering experience, including project management responsibility
  • Experience leading projects and interfacing directly with clients
  • Strong background in steel and concrete design (exposure to industrial or complex projects a plus)
  • Proficiency with structural analysis and design software (e.g., RISA, RAM, STAAD, Enercalc)
  • Familiarity with AutoCAD and/or Revit
  • Excellent communication, leadership, and organizational skills
  • Ability to manage multiple projects while maintaining technical quality and deadlines
